French want less work

MOST French people think companies should be allowed exemptions to the country’s 35-hour working week if their unions agree, a poll said yesterday.

France’s new Economy Minister Emmanuel Macron caused a stir this week by floating the idea as a way for firms to boost confidence and competitiveness.
